DIVISIONAL SUPERINTENDENT, PAKISTAN RAILWAYS versus SINDH LABOUR APPELLATE TRIBUNAL


Industrial Relations Ordinance 1969 Section 25A Demarcation Act (IX of 1908), Section 4 Constitution of Pakistan (1973), Article 199 affirming the dismissal of the appeal by the Labor Appellate Tribunal on the basis of limitations from the Labor Appellate Tribunal 26 12 1996 Closed for winter holidays. On 1 9 1997, the Labor Court approved the respondent's reinstatement order on 11 11 1996, the applicant had time to file an appeal to the Labor Courts and Labor Appellate Tribunals by 30 12 1996, however, the opening of the Labor Appellate Tribunal. Holidays and applicants witnessed the day. Filed Appeal The beneficiary of Section 4, Limitation Act, 1908, and his appeal will be considered within time, the fact is that during the winter holidays of the Labor Appellate Tribunal, his office is open, The applicant shall not lose the benefits of Section 4, the Limitation Act. , 1908, in which the extension of the term of limitation is proposed if the expiry of the day of closure of the court was not possible, then no extension of the expression could be given to the court so that the office could also be included in it. To add that when the Labor Appellate Tribunal was closed on holidays, it would not expire, there would be no time limit for filing an appeal on the opening day and the Labor Appellate Tribunal's order would have been canceled. Received remand for appeal decision on merit
